Brian Souza is the author of the New York Times bestseller, The Weekly Coaching Conversation and the critically acclaimed book, Become Who You Were Born to Be (Random House, 2007) which has been published in multiple languages around the world.
Souza is the founder and president of ProductivityDrivers — an innovative corporate training company specializing in improving employee performance and organizational productivity. As a respected thought leader in leadership development, organizational productivity, and sales, Souza is highly sought after as a keynote speaker and management consultant by top companies and organizations worldwide.
Prior to founding ProductivityDrivers, Souza was the founder and CEO of GetListed and Paragon Holdings. Early in his career he worked in various sales and sales leadership positions with Akamai Technologies, NetGravity, and Netscape Communications. Souza lives in San Diego with his wife and two daughters.
